信息的传输方法、装置和系统制造方法及图纸

技术编号:34437470 阅读:24 留言:0更新日期:2022-08-06 16:22
本申请提供一种信息的传输方法、装置和系统,该方法应用于区块链中的节点,包括:向第一区块链中的其他节点发送第一交易;第一交易包括第一事件标识和交易条件;第一事件标识用于关联第一交易和其他区块链中的交易,例如第二区块链中的第二交易;交易条件包括:第二区块链中标识为第一事件标识的第二交易完成后,执行第一区块链的第一交易,在确定满足交易条件时,获取包含第一交易的区块。即再确认第二交易执行完成,满足交易条件后将第一交易执行完成,实现多个物联网之间的跨链交互。实现多个物联网之间的跨链交互。实现多个物联网之间的跨链交互。

【技术实现步骤摘要】
信息的传输方法、装置和系统
[0001]本申请是分案申请,原申请的申请号是201710503177.7,原申请日是2017年06月27日,原申请的全部内容通过引用结合在本申请中。


[0002]本申请涉及通信技术,尤其涉及一种信息的传输方法、装置和系统。

技术介绍

[0003]物联网作为互联网基础上延伸和扩展的网络,通过应用智能感知、识别技术与普适计算等计算机技术,实现信息交换和通信,同样能满足区块链系统的部署和运营要求。随着物联网中设备数量的增长,如果以传统的中心化网络模式进行管理,将带来巨大的数据中心基础设施建设投入及维护投入。此外,基于中心化的网络模式也会存在安全隐患。区块链的去中心化特性为物联网的自我治理提供了方法,可以帮助物联网中的设备理解彼此,并让物联网中的设备知道不同设备之间的关系,实现对分布式物联网的去中心化控制。如果将区块链技术应用于智能家居中,区块链智能家居相关的生活设备可以自主完成相关的交易,例如家里洗衣机可以自动购买洗衣液,完成交易过程。
[0004]区块链是由包含交易信息的区块有序链接起来的数据结构。目前本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种信息的传输方法,其特征在于,所述方法包括:接收通知消息,所述通知消息来自至少一个第二区块链中的节点,或者来自第二区块链中生成包含所述第二交易的区块的节点,或者来自连接节点,所述连接节点用于连接所述第一区块链与所述第二区块链。2.根据权利要求1所述的方法,其特征在于,所述通知消息包括以下至少一项:所述第一事件标识,所述第二区块链的标识,第二交易的标识和包含所述第二交易的区块标识,第一区块链的标识。3.根据权利要求1所述的方法,其特征在于,所述方法还包括:向所述第一区块链中的其他节点发送第一交易;所述第一交易包括第一事件标识和交易条件;所述第一事件标识用于关联所述第一区块链的第一交易和第二区块链的第二交易;所述交易条件包括:第二区块链中包含所述第一事件标识的第二交易完成后,执行所述第一区块链的第一交易;在确定满足所述交易条件时,获取包含所述第一交易的区块。4.根据权利要求3所述的方法,其特征在于,所述获取包含所述第一交易的区块,包括:在所述第一区块链中生成包含所述第一交易的区块;或者,接收所述第一区块链中的其他至少一个节点发送的包含所述第一交易的区块。5.根据权利要求3或4所述的方法,其特征在于,确定满足所述交易条件,包括:确定所述第二区块链的区块中包含所述第二交易,则满足所述第一交易的所述交易条件。6.根据权利要求5所述的方法,其特征在于,所述确定所述第二区块链的区块中包含所述第二交易,包括:接收通知消息;所述通知消息用于通知所述第二交易执行完成;根据所述通知消息确定所述第二区块链中的区块包含所述第二交易。7.根据权利要求4所述的方法,其特征在于,所述确定所述第二区块链的区块中包含所述第二交易,还包括:根据所述通知消息读取所述第二区块链的内容,根据所述第一事件标识确认所述第二交易已写入所述第二区块链中的区块。8.根据权利要求3至7任一项所述的方法,其特征在于,确定满足所述交易条件,包括:获取所述第二区块链中与包含所述第二交易的区块的深度;当所述第二区块链中包含所述第二交易的区块的深度大于预设深度时,确定满足所述交易条件。9.根据权利要求3所述的方法,其特征在于,向所述第一区块链中的其他节点发送第一交易之前,所述方法还包括:接收第一触发消息,所述第一触发消息用于触发所述第一区块链的节点生成所述第一交易;根据所述第一触发消息生成所述第一交易。10.根据权利要求3所述的方法,其特征在于,所述方法还包括:向所述第二区块链的至少一个节点发送第二触发消息,所述第二触发消息用于触发所
述第二区块链的节点生成所述第二交易。11.根据权利要求3、8或9任一项所述的方法,其特征在于,所述方法还包括:接收发送的第三触发消息,所述第三触发消息用于触发所述第一区块链的节点生成第三交易;所述第三触发消息包括第二事件标识,所述第二事件标识用于关联所述第一交易;根据所述第三触发消息生成所述第三交易;或者,接收所述第一区块链的其他节点发送的第三交易;其中,所述第三交易包括第一连接标识,所述第一连接标识用于关联所述第一区块链中的至少两个交易。12.根据权利要求11所述的方法,其特征在于,所述第二事件标识包括所述第一事件标识。13.一种信息的传输方法,其特征在于,所述方法包括:向所述第一区块链中的至少一个节点发送通知消息;所述通知消息用于通知所述第二交易执行完成。14.根据权利要求13所述的方法,其特征在于,所述通知消息包括以下至少一项:所述第一事件标识,所述第二区块链的标识,第二交易的标识和包含所述第二交易的区块标识,第一区块链的标识。15.根据权利要求13或14所述的方法,其特征在于,所述方法还包括:向所述第二区块链中的其他节点发送第二交...

【专利技术属性】
技术研发人员:张亮亮冯淑兰常俊仁张臣雄
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1